Comparison review

Samsung Gravity 3 has a general score of 37.9, which is a little bit better than the LG KE500's 35 global score. The Samsung Gravity 3 is a a lot heavier and a little bit thicker device than the LG KE500. The Samsung Gravity 3 has a slightly better looking screen than LG KE500, because it has a bit more pixels per display inch and a better resolution of 320 x 240.

The LG KE500 features just a little better hardware performance than Samsung Gravity 3, although it has a lower number of cores and they are also slower. The Samsung Gravity 3 counts with a very superior memory for games and applications than LG KE500. Both of them have equal 71,68 MB internal storage capacity.

The Samsung Gravity 3 counts with improved battery performance than LG KE500, because it has 1000mAh of battery capacity. The LG KE500 and the Samsung Gravity 3 both count with very similar cameras, both have a same resolution camera in the back.

Even being the best phone in our current comparison, the Samsung Gravity 3 is also the cheapest.
